Find the SUM of -12.34 and -8.5

To find the sum of -12.34 and -8.5, you simply add the two numbers together:
\[
-12.34 + (-8.5) = -12.34 - 8.5
\]
To perform the addition more easily, you can convert -8.5 into a decimal with two decimal places:
\[
-8.5 = -8.50
\]
Now add the two numbers:
\[
-12.34 - 8.50 = -20.84
\]
So, the sum of -12.34 and -8.5 is \(-20.84\).
